摘要
A synthetic time-frequency analytic method is proposed in this paper. Complex Morlet wavelet and analytic wavelet transformation are applied to process multi-burst signal. Combining with the application of Laser Phase-Doppler technology in the detecting of dust particles, the thesis delivers the processing method of multi-burst signal and the relevant influencing factors systemically.
